Karen

>     I'm looking for a setup that will allow me to project what I'm
>     working on at the bench so that the students in my class can see
>     it clearly (and obviously much larger). 

    The term you are looking for is LCD Projector, they do work off a
    computer, or some other input device such as thumb drive or TV tuner. 


    Get as high a lumen count as you can afford and hi aspect ratio.
    Whatever you use for an optical device, if you can show it on a
    computer screen, you can display it on a wall with one of these. My
    purpose in it was showing techs how they could repair wave guides in
    the field under adverse working conditions and get the equipment back
    up with a very small flight friendly kit. Wave guides are silver
    soldered and these units used a coated aluminum as wave guides.
    Overheating was a major concern in their repair, being able to show
    the students the 'flash' that occurred was paramount to the training
    success. 

    The camera I used was an issued item from the photo shop with an AVI
    output, the camera had a 12X optical magnification and would display
    real time to my laptop. Unfortunately I do not remember the brand of
    camera. But I do remember that I could set it about 2 feet away from
    my station and still get a good quality display.
